What are Cryptocurrency Tokens?
At their core, a cryptocurrency token is a digital asset issued on top of an existing blockchain. Unlike cryptocurrencies like Bitcoin which have their own independent blockchain, tokens are created and operate *on* another blockchain. Think of the blockchain as an operating system (like Windows or macOS) and tokens as applications running on that system. The most common blockchain used for token creation is Ethereum, due to its smart contract functionality, but others like Binance Smart Chain, Solana, and Cardano are also popular.
Tokens represent a variety of assets or utilities, ranging from voting rights and access to services to representations of real-world assets like gold or real estate. They are created through a process called a token generation event (TGE) or an Initial Coin Offering (ICO) – though ICOs are less common now due to regulatory concerns.
Tokens vs. Cryptocurrencies: Key Differences
The distinction between tokens and cryptocurrencies is often blurred, leading to confusion. Here’s a breakdown of the key differences:
Feature | Cryptocurrency | Token |
---|---|---|
Blockchain | Own independent blockchain | Built on top of an existing blockchain |
Primary Function | Digital currency; store of value | Represents an asset, utility, or access right |
Example | Bitcoin (BTC), Litecoin (LTC) | Chainlink (LINK), Uniswap (UNI) |
Genesis | Created as the native currency of a blockchain | Created through a token generation event on an existing blockchain |
Essentially, all cryptocurrencies are digital assets, but not all digital assets are cryptocurrencies. Tokens *rely* on the underlying blockchain for security and operation, while cryptocurrencies *are* the blockchain.
Types of Cryptocurrency Tokens
Tokens come in a wide variety of forms, each serving a different purpose. Understanding these types is essential for informed investment decisions.
- Utility Tokens: These tokens provide access to a specific product or service within a particular ecosystem. For example, Basic Attention Token (BAT) is used within the Brave browser to reward users for their attention to ads. Their value is derived from the utility they provide. Analyzing the project’s trading volume can indicate the demand for the utility.
- Security Tokens: These tokens represent ownership in a real-world asset, such as equity in a company, a share of real estate, or a fraction of a valuable artwork. They are subject to securities regulations, similar to traditional stocks and bonds. Technical analysis of securities tokens will often incorporate traditional financial metrics.
- Payment Tokens: Similar to cryptocurrencies, these tokens are designed to be used as a medium of exchange. While Bitcoin is the most prominent example, many tokens aim to facilitate payments within specific ecosystems or communities. Analyzing their market capitalization is vital.
- Governance Tokens: These tokens grant holders the right to vote on proposals related to the development and operation of a blockchain project. Uniswap (UNI) is a prime example, allowing holders to influence the future of the decentralized exchange. Understanding the project’s whitepaper is crucial before investing in governance tokens.
- Non-Fungible Tokens (NFTs): Perhaps the most widely publicized type of token, NFTs represent unique digital assets, such as artwork, collectibles, and in-game items. Unlike other tokens, NFTs are not interchangeable. NFT trading volume has exploded in recent years, but is also highly volatile.
- Stablecoins: These tokens are designed to maintain a stable value, typically pegged to a fiat currency like the US dollar. Tether (USDT) and USD Coin (USDC) are popular examples. They are often used as a safe haven in the volatile crypto market and are crucial for arbitrage trading.
Token Standards
To ensure interoperability and functionality, tokens adhere to specific standards. These standards define the technical specifications of the token, allowing them to interact seamlessly with wallets, exchanges, and decentralized applications (dApps).
- ERC-20: The most widely used token standard on the Ethereum blockchain. It defines a set of functions that tokens must implement, such as transferring tokens and querying the token balance.
- ERC-721: The standard for NFTs on Ethereum. It allows for the creation of unique, indivisible tokens.
- BEP-20: The token standard on Binance Smart Chain, similar to ERC-20.
- SPL (Solana Program Library): The standard for tokens on the Solana blockchain.
Understanding these standards is crucial for developers and users alike, as it ensures compatibility and security.
The Role of Smart Contracts
Smart contracts are self-executing contracts written in code and stored on the blockchain. They are essential for the creation and functionality of tokens. When a token is created, a smart contract defines its rules, such as the total supply, how tokens can be transferred, and any specific functionalities.
For example, a smart contract for a utility token might define that only users who hold a certain number of tokens can access a premium feature within an application. The transparency and immutability of smart contracts are key advantages of blockchain technology. Auditing the smart contract’s code is a vital step in assessing a token’s security.
Risks Associated with Cryptocurrency Tokens
Investing in cryptocurrency tokens carries significant risks, which potential investors must be aware of:
- Volatility: The crypto market is notoriously volatile, and token prices can fluctuate dramatically in short periods. Employing risk management strategies is crucial.
- Regulatory Uncertainty: The regulatory landscape surrounding cryptocurrencies and tokens is still evolving, and changes in regulations could negatively impact token prices.
- Security Risks: Smart contracts are vulnerable to bugs and exploits, which could lead to the loss of funds. Rug pulls, where developers abandon a project and abscond with investors’ money, are also a significant risk. Due diligence is paramount.
- Liquidity Risks: Some tokens have limited liquidity, making it difficult to buy or sell them quickly without affecting the price.
- Project Risks: Many token projects fail to deliver on their promises, resulting in a loss of investment. Evaluating the project’s team, roadmap, and technology is essential.
- Scams: The crypto space is rife with scams, including pump-and-dump schemes and phishing attacks. Be wary of unsolicited offers and always verify information independently.
